Enliven Southland The Enliven service philosophy recognises that, some things make for healthier, happier living, no matter what your age or abilitiy.

Whether you’re in your own home and looking to remain connected, start your next chapter in our retirement villages, or for a place in our care homes, we’re here to offer practical support and genuine connection. A sense of community; friends, family, whānau; giving and receiving; making decisions for yourself; and, most of all, practical support when you need it. At Enliven we work alongside you

and your family to achieve these things. Our Care staff will spend time getting to know you and your family, tailoring our range of services to meet your unique needs. We believe it’s important to support your emotional, cultural and social needs, as well as any practical day-to-day requirements. We aim to build on your strengths in a way that preserves dignity and promotes overall wellbeing. Services and support provided by Enliven in Southland include:

* spacious and well-presented retirement living options
* practical support enabling older people to continue living in their own home
* warm, welcoming and friendly rest homes and hospitals
* rest home and hospital level care for those living with dementia

Thank you to Invercargill City Libraries and Archives archives team for coming along to talk to our SupportLink coffee group this morning. They talked about the services offered by Archives and the types of documents, memorabilia and photos they have in their extensive collection, from city council files, schools and community and sports groups to the Anglican church and families in Southland.
